The Anglican Chorale & Friends – Variety Concert “Celebrating The Joy Of Music”

Nassau, Bahamas - Under the patronage of The Right Rev’d Laish Boyd, Sr. and Mrs. Boyd The Anglican Chorale and Friends will present a variety concert: “Celebrating the Joy of Music” at Christ Church Cathedral, George Street on Friday, 25th July, 2014, commencing at 8:00 p.m.

In addition to The Anglican Chorale featured performers will include The Bahamas Christian Chorale (conducted by Darville “Sonny” Walkine), The Highgrove Singers (conducted by Adrian Archer), The Bel-Canto Singers (conducted by Eldridge McPhee), The Roman Catholic Diocesan Chorale (conducted by Demetrius Delancy), and solo and instrumental performances by Karrington McKenzie, Colyn Major, Danielle Dorsett, Ashley Minnis, Giovanni Clarke and Brian Saunders. There will be music of all genres that will appeal to all tastes – classical, gospel, contemporary and Negro spirituals. So come out and let’s celebrate.

Tickets at $20 are on sale at Logos Book Store, Harbour Bay (Tel: 394-7040) and St. Agnes Church Office, Blue Hill road (Tel: 325-2640) or from Anglican Chorale members. Part proceeds are in aid of the restoration of Family Island churches.
